    Antiviral drugs

    Antiviral drugs are pharmaceutical medications that help fight off viruses that can cause disease. Antiviral drugs can also prevent infection, viral spread, or reduce the symptoms caused by viral infection. Viruses such as influenza, herpes, hepatitis, HIV, and SARS-CoV-2.
